Transaction e046643294c8ba595249cc2fc8350b4006981f97bf4883bbf34af03d56bfeecf
1 Input
1 Output
-
e046643294c8ba595249cc2fc8350b4006981f97bf4883bbf34af03d56bfeecf:0
- value
- 42417703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d153e760efabcc1cece7bb3d0ad308e789b3df5 OP_EQUAL
- address
- 3Jvo5riLHy5Mh4iz7VefKgAABYyaTWpz1A